Manufacturing Process & Operational Model Insights
In House Outsourced
• Mamata Machinery focuses on in-house high-end design, engineering, assembly, and testing while outsourcing mechanical tasks.
• Software and coding required for controlling the machines are developed in-house at the manufacturing facility of a company.
• Products are built to order, with designs provided by the company, supported by a dedicated vendor network for component
Optimised
manufacturing.
Manufacturing • Components like servo drives, HMIs, and electronics are sourced externally.
Facility • The company’s robust IT infrastructure includes Microsoft SQL servers and a fully customized in-house ERP system covering all key
operations.

Pioneering Technology Through Advanced R&D & Patents
Patents:
• Four granted patents for high-speed bag stacking, flat-bottom pouch-
making, cross sealing device and multi-purpose sealing module for
plastic film-based bags and pouches making machine.
R&D Team:
87 engineers and application experts in electronics,
mechanical, software design.
